Dermatologist Reviews CeraVe Invisible Mineral SPF 50 | No White Cast?



Dermatologist Dr. Dray reviews the new CeraVe Invisible Mineral Sunscreen SPF 50. Mineral sunscreens are often thick and leave a white cast, making them hard to use consistently. In this video, Dr. Dray breaks down how this sunscreen works, how it applies, how it looks on the skin, and who it is best suited for.

This is a 100% mineral sunscreen with zinc oxide and titanium dioxide contains ceramides and niacinamide to support the skin barrier. Dr. Dray also discusses finish, white cast, makeup compatibility, price, and alternatives for those sensitive to niacinamide.
